So there's EX and M(mega) EX, which if any of these die your opponent draws 2 prize card. A mega is the evolution of the same name EX card, are they worth it even if double payout by opponent, certainly depending on your deck they can wasily be 3-4x stronger then a normal card.

Break cards still pretty new to them myself but ultimately they are a evolution put sideways on the card and give extra attacks to the pokemon (might also add HP).

Meta decks... you can look online for tournament winners but ultimately cycle to get combo of cards ASAP.

Keep playing and if you can grind versus to get a bunch of points and extra packs/coins.

What to use coins on, depends what cards your looking to get really depending on needs certain packs are better then others.
